Midvale is a suburb of Perth, Western Australia, located within the City of Swan. Its postcode is 6056. Developed in the early 1950s, the area is between Midland and the former Helena Vale Racecourse, hence the name is a composite of the two places. Midland (31°53′S 116°00′E) is both a suburb and a township in the Perth, Western Australia metropolitan area, and is the regional centre for the City of Swan local government area that covers the Swan Valley and parts of the Darling Scarp to the east.
The Midland Military Markets at the northern edge of the Midland Saleyards - literally utilises an old Military site for a weekend markets, not far west and adjacent to the Lloyd Street railway crossing - a large Harvey Norman store was opened in 2005 on the corner of Clayton and Lloyd Streets.
The Coal Storage dam at the western side of the Workshops has become an ornamental lake adjacent to residential redevelopment called 'Woodbridge Lakes'.
